When announcing his exit, the Dundee United official website said: “After keeping 36 clean sheets in 85 appearances between the sticks and topping the William Hill Premiership save charts with a staggering 112 stops throughout the term, Jack Walton returns to Luton Town with our sincere gratitude for his services as he looks to challenge for the number one jersey at Kenilworth Road.”
Discussing his return from the Scottish side, Walton, who, along with midfielder Liam Walsh, had their contracts with the Hatters extended by an extra 12 months, wrote on Instagram: “It’s been an Amazing 2 years Arabs! Thank you to the fans for the support and love you have given me whilst I’ve been at the club. Enjoy the European tour.”
